  • Simple Experiment With Candles

    Episode 568

    This is a simple science experiment but so much learning is happening here. We confirmed that oxygen is needed for fire to burn and compared how different volume glasses influence the speed with which candles go off

  • Simple Experiment with Cornflakes and Magnet #1

    Episode 569

    A quick experiment with magnetic cornflakes for a breakfast. If you read the label on the pack of corn flakes, you will see a list of vitamins and IRON. Magnet attracts that small amount of iron

  • Simple And Fun Activities For Children and Toddlers

    Episode 562

    This is a fun exploring activity. I have coloured water with kids paint to make sure it is not translucent, put a jar upside down in the water, added a bit of water to the bottom of the jar to create magnifying glass effect and let Alex and Max to look for hidden dinosaurs at the bottom of the ocean
